Pinpoint Test V: No Power To The Scan Tool

Refer to Wiring Diagram Set 14, Module Communications Network for schematic and connector information. Diagrams By Number

Normal Operation

The scan tool is connected to the Data Link Connector (DLC) to communicate with the High Speed Controller Area Network (HS-CAN) and the Medium Speed Controller Area Network (MS-CAN) communications network. Voltage for the scan tool is provided by circuit SBP11 (BU/RD). Ground is provided by both circuits GD116 (BK/VT).

This pinpoint test is intended to diagnose the following:

- Fuse
- Wiring, terminals or connectors
- Scan tool



PINPOINT TEST V: NO POWER TO THE SCAN TOOL

NOTE: Failure to disconnect the battery when instructed will result in false resistance readings. Refer to Battery.

-------------------------------------------------
V1 CHECK THE DLC PINS FOR DAMAGE


NOTE: Most faults are due to connector and/or wiring concerns. Carry out a thorough inspection and verification before proceeding with the pinpoint test.

- Disconnect the scan tool cable from the DLC.
- Inspect DLC pins 4, 5 and 16 for damage.




- Are DLC pins 4, 5 and 16 OK?

Yes
GO to V2.

No
REPAIR the DLC as necessary. CLEAR the DTCs. REPEAT the network test with the scan tool.

-------------------------------------------------
V2 CHECK THE DLC VOLTAGE SUPPLY FOR AN OPEN


- Measure the voltage between the DLC C251-16, circuit SBP11 (BU/RD), harness side and ground.




- Is the voltage greater than 10 volts?

Yes
GO to V3.

No
VERIFY the Smart Junction Box (SJB) fuse 18 (20A) is OK. If OK, REPAIR the circuit. REPEAT the network test with the scan tool.

-------------------------------------------------
V3 CHECK THE DLC GROUND CIRCUITS FOR AN OPEN


- Disconnect: Negative Battery Cable.
- Measure the resistance between the DLC C251-4, circuit GD116 (BK/VT), harness side and ground; and between the DLC C251-5, circuit GD116 (BK/VT), harness side and ground.




- Are the resistances less than 5 ohms?

Yes
CONNECT the negative battery cable. REPAIR the scan tool. REPEAT the network test with the scan tool.

No
CONNECT the negative battery cable. REPAIR the circuit in question. REPEAT the network test with the scan tool.

-------------------------------------------------
